    Porsche: a difficult 2025, but a clear strategy for bouncing back

    On Wednesday 11 March 2026, Porsche held its annual press conference to present its financial results for 2025 and detail its strategy for the years ahead. The German manufacturer acknowledged that it had been through one of the most difficult years in its recent history. With declining sales, a sharp fall in profits and a strategic reorientation of the brand, 2025 clearly marks a turning point for Porsche, which is now trying to revive its momentum while continuing its transition to electric vehicles. Almost simultaneously, on the eve of this conference, Porsche presented its new zero-emission model: the Porsche Cayenne S Electric.

    source : Porsche

    2025 results down sharply

    The figures unveiled this morning show a real slowdown. In 2025, Porsche generated sales of €36.27 billion, compared with €40.1 billion in 2024, a fall of around 9.5%. But it is above all profitability that has collapsed. Operating profit (EBIT) fell to 410 million euros, compared with 5.64 billion euros the previous year, a spectacular drop of 92.7%. The operating margin, usually very high at Porsche, fell to 1.1%, compared with 14.1% in 2024, while net profit was €310 million, down 91.4%.

    In terms of volumes, Porsche delivered 279,449 vehicles in 2025, down 10.1% on the previous year. However, 100% electric models accounted for 22.2% of deliveries, in line with the brand’s initial target of 20-22%.

    A number of factors

    According to the manufacturer’s management, a large part of the fall in profitability stems from charges estimated at €3.9 billion. These include €2.4 billion linked to a strategic reorientation of the range, €700 million of depreciation on batteries and €700 million of impact linked to customs duties in the United States since the return of President Trump’s “America First” policy.

    The slowdown in the Chinese market also weighed heavily. In this key market for premium manufacturers, Porsche sales fell by 26%. This is not an isolated decline for the brand; BMW (-12.5%) and Mercedes (-19%) have also been affected. Added to this are the additional costs associated with the transition to electric vehicles, particularly the Porsche Taycan and Porsche Macan Electric, as well as the significant investment in software development carried out with the Volkswagen Group via the Cariad subsidiary.

    “Global challenges and the company’s new direction have had an impact on the 2025 result,” summarised CFO Jochen Breckner at the conference.

    A strategy to turn things around

    Faced with this situation, Porsche’s new CEO, Michael Leiters, has presented a strategic plan based on three pillars: ‘Leaner, Faster, More Desirable’. The first pillar, Leaner, aims to make the company leaner by reducing fixed costs, which means that Porsche plans to cut around 1,900 jobs by 2029.

    The second pillar, Faster, is designed to speed up development cycles and concentrate resources on the models that are most important to the brand. Five vehicles now form the core of the product strategy: the Porsche 911, the Porsche Cayenne, the Porsche Macan, the Porsche Taycan and the Porsche 718.

    Finally, the More Desirable theme is intended to reinforce the brand’s emotional image. Porsche wants to continue to focus on personalisation and exclusivity in order to maintain its top-of-the-range positioning, even with potentially lower volumes. “We are repositioning Porsche in an integral way, more efficient, faster and with even more attractive products,” said Michael Leiters.

    A new electric Cayenne unveiled the day before

    Electricity never stops for Porsche. On the eve of this annual conference, the German manufacturer presented a new version of its zero-emission SUV: the Porsche Cayenne S Electric. This version completes the Cayenne’s electric range by positioning itself in the middle of the range, between the entry-level Cayenne Electric and the Cayenne Turbo Electric.

    source : Porsche

     

    Like the other versions of the SUV, this model is based on the Premium Platform Electric (PPE), an 800-volt architecture developed jointly with Audi. The Cayenne S Electric has a power output of 400 kW (544 bhp), which can be increased to 490 kW (666 bhp) with Launch Control, thanks to its dual powertrain and all-wheel drive. Acceleration is faithful to the brand’s sporting DNA, with a 0-100 kph time of 3.8 seconds and a top speed of 250 kph.

    In terms of range and recharging performance, it’s convincing on paper, with the brand announcing a 113 kWh high-voltage battery, giving a range of up to 653 km WLTP. Thanks to the 800 V architecture, recharging power can reach 400 kW at a rapid charging point, taking the battery from 10% to 80% in around 16 minutes.

    Renault R-Space Lab: the concept that could inspire tomorrow’s electric Mégane

    At the presentation of its new FutuREady strategic plan on 10 March 2026, Renault did more than just announce its industrial ambitions for the end of the decade. The French manufacturer also unveiled an unexpected concept car: the Renault R-Space Lab. More a rolling laboratory (hence the name) than a production vehicle, it is designed to explore what Renault calls “cars for living”. Behind this experimental approach lie a number of technologies and design ideas that could inspire the brand’s next generation of electric models, including a certain Mégane.

    source : Renault

    A concept unveiled at the heart of the FutuREady strategic plan

    We were expecting to see just two prototypes: the Renault Bridger Concept, an electric 4×4 designed to explore the family SUV segment, and the Dacia Striker, a concept estate designed for the Romanian brand. The surprise was complete this morning, when the R-Space Lab was also presented. Renault’s objective is clear: to provide a concrete illustration of the group’s vision for the next decade.

    With 12 new models planned in Europe between now and 2030 and a further 14 for international markets, the carmaker wants to speed up its transformation while placing greater emphasis on the on-board experience. The R-Space Lab is tasked with testing new ideas for interior architecture, safety and digital interfaces.

    A return to the MPV’s roots

    Visually, the concept is surprising in its proportions. At 4.50 metres long, the R-Space Lab is midway between the compact Renault Mégane E-Tech Electric (4.21 m) and the Renault Captur urban SUV. But unlike these models, its design adopts a very pronounced single-volume silhouette, with a windscreen that protrudes well forward and a continuous glass surface that stretches from the bonnet all the way to the rear window.

    source : Renault

    This stylistic choice is in keeping with Renault’s historic tradition of family vehicles centred on space and modularity. In fact, the concept’s name is a direct reference to the Renault R-Space Concept, which was presented in 2011 and foreshadowed several design elements of the Renault Scenic IV launched five years later. Once again, Renault could use this prototype to test the proportions of a future generation of more spacious electric models, potentially somewhere between a compact and an MPV.

    The cabin as a real living space

    But the heart of the project is not in the exterior design. The R-Space Lab has been designed around a simple idea: to transform the interior of the vehicle into a modular living space, capable of adapting to the daily needs of families.

    The front passenger seat thus becomes a truly multifunctional element. It integrates the front and curtain airbags directly into its structure, freeing up space in the dashboard. The glovebox can be transformed into a shelf, a storage space for a bag or even a footrest. The seat can also slide backwards, allowing the front passenger to interact face-to-face with the occupants seated in the rear.

    The rear, we’re talking about it, we’re there. Renault has come up with three independent sliding seats, Renault Espace style, combined with a panoramic glass roof.

    source : Renault

    A giant screen that goes right through the windscreen

    Now it’s time to move on to the technological side of things, where the concept also introduces a number of digital innovations that could rapidly move into production.

    The most spectacular is the OpenR Panorama system, a giant curved screen that extends across the entire width of the windscreen. Inspired by the interface of the Renault Scénic Vision concept, this solution aims to merge instrumentation and infotainment into a single display surface.

    The prototype also adopts a yoke-type steering wheel combined with steer-by-wire steering, i.e. with no direct mechanical link between the steering wheel and the wheels. This system, already used on some models, allows greater freedom in the design of the cockpit.

    source : Renault

    Security rethought thanks to artificial intelligence

    The R-Space Lab also serves as a testing ground for new safety systems. For example, the concept features a device called Safety Coach, which uses sensors and algorithms to analyse driver behaviour.

    In particular, the system can detect signs of drunkenness using integrated tactile sensors, while providing personalised recommendations via on-board artificial intelligence. The aim is to create a permanent interaction between the car and its driver in order to improve road safety.

    A possible glimpse of the electric Mégane of 2028

    Although Renault insists on the experimental nature of the project, a number of clues suggest that some of the R-Space Lab’s ideas could inspire production models. The proportions of the concept, for example, could herald a future generation of longer electric compact cars, at around 4.40 to 4.50 metres.

    Several observers are already talking about a possible second generation of the Renault Mégane E-Tech Electric around 2028, which would adopt proportions closer to those of a compact MPV in order to improve passenger space.

    source : Renault

    Although the R-Space Lab will never be marketed as such, it could well herald a new generation of Renault electric vehicles in which the passenger compartment will become the heart of innovation.

    Volkswagen: 4 million BEVs delivered… but 50,000 jobs lost

    The Volkswagen Group took advantage of its Annual Media Conference 2026, held on March 10 in Wolfsburg, to unveil its 2025 financial results and detail the progress of its industrial transformation. Chief Executive Oliver Blume and Chief Financial Officer Arno Antlitz drew a mixed picture: the German giant remains one of the world leaders in electromobility, but the energy transition is weighing heavily on its profitability. With 4 million 100% electric vehicles delivered worldwide, the group also announced a shock measure: 50,000 job cuts in Germany by 2030.

    source: Volkswagen Group

    Solid volumes but profitability under pressure

    In financial terms, 2025 is a perfect illustration of the transition phase that Volkswagen is going through. The company recorded sales of €321.9 billion, down slightly on the €324.7 billion recorded in 2024. Worldwide sales also remained at a high level, with 9 million vehicles delivered over the year.

    But profitability deteriorated sharply. Operating income fell by more than 50% to €8.9 billion, compared with €19.1 billion a year earlier. The operating margin fell to 2.8%, its lowest level since Dieselgate in 2016. Oliver Blume insisted on making it clear that 2025 is “a year of financial resilience but margins under pressure.”

    source: Wikipedia

     

    This fall was mainly due to exceptional charges of €9 billion, linked to a number of factors:

    • 5 billion to adapt Porsche’s electric strategy
    • 3 billion linked to US tariffs
    • 1 billion spent on internal restructuring

    Despite this pressure on profits, the automotive division’s net cash flow reached 6.4 billion euros, up 24% year-on-year.

    Volkswagen confirms its place in global electromobility

    Despite the worrying figures, Volkswagen sent out a clear message: the BEV strategy remains intact. A few days before the conference, the Group announced that it had delivered a cumulative total of 4 million 100% electric vehicles worldwide (Top 5 worldwide and Top 1 in Europe).

    The conference also revealed, or at least confirmed, that over the last two years the Group has launched almost 60 new models, around a third of which are fully electric. The Group’s BEV range now exceeds 30 models for passenger cars, plus the electric trucks and buses produced by its industrial subsidiary TRATON, which includes Scania and MAN.

    source: Volkswagen Group

    Slowing down is not an option for the group, and the product offensive will continue. Volkswagen is planning more than 20 new models for 2026, around half of which will be 100% electric. Among them is a strategic project for Europe: the Electric Urban Car Family, a new generation of four affordable electric city cars designed to democratise electric mobility in the entry-level segment.

    At the same time, the Group is preparing several new electric models specifically developed for the Chinese market, which has become the centre of gravity of the global energy transition.

    50,000 job cuts: the social shock

    But the most talked-about announcement of the conference concerned the Group’s social restructuring. In his letter to shareholders published with the annual report, Oliver Blume confirms that almost 50,000 jobs are expected to be cut in Germany between now and 2030 within the Volkswagen Group.

    source: Richard Bartz

    This decision goes well beyond the social plan already negotiated in 2024 with the powerful German trade union IG Metall. Back then, an agreement provided for 35,000 job cuts at Volkswagen.

    And while originally only Volkswagen was to be affected, this time several brands are likely to be involved: Audi, Porsche and Cariad.

    The unions are sure to be in the news, but management has insisted on a “socially responsible” approach, based mainly on voluntary redundancies, early retirement and internal redeployment.

    Future Packages: the plan to restore profitability

    To emerge from this transitional phase, Volkswagen is focusing on a vast internal efficiency programme called Future Packages. The objective is clear: to achieve annual savings of more than €6 billion by 2030, using a number of industrial levers.

    In particular, the Group plans to simplify its vehicle range, improve the productivity of its factories and strengthen synergies between its various brands. As a reminder, the Volkswagen Group catalogue comprises several brands, each with its own positioning: Volkswagen, Audi, Škoda, Cupra, Porsche and many others.

    Lotus Eletre X: the hybrid makes its mark

    For several years, Lotus Cars seemed determined to turn the page on combustion engines once and for all. In 2023, the British manufacturer still claimed that the sporty Lotus Emira would be its “last internal combustion car”, as part of a strategy to become a 100% electric brand by the end of the decade. Three years on, the brand has revised its ambitions. With the arrival of the Lotus Eletre X, the British manufacturer is introducing a plug-in hybrid powertrain for the first time in its history.

    source : Lotus

    A revelation from China

    We’ve known it since 5 December 2025, when the Chinese Ministry of Industry and Technology published an approval file for a vehicle called “Eletre For Me”. Behind this name lies the future plug-in hybrid version of the 100% electric SUV launched by Lotus in 2023.

    source: Automobile sportive

    Confirmed by Lotus Cars at the beginning of 2026, the timetable is now clear: the first deliveries are expected in China at the end of March 2026, before a European launch scheduled for June. The French market should be served a few months later, by the end of the year.

    This development comes at a particular time for the manufacturer. Although the brand’s electric models, in particular the Lotus Eletre and the Lotus Emeya saloon, have enabled Lotus Cars to achieve a record 12,134 worldwide deliveries in 2024, their volumes are still below the manufacturer’s initial ambitions, which were initially aimed at more than 25,000 annual sales in the medium term.

    source: TopGear

    An even more powerful hyper-SUV

    In technical terms, the Lotus Eletre X not only adds a combustion engine to the existing electric SUV, it also becomes the most powerful version in the range. The hybrid system develops a total output of 952 bhp, compared with ‘just’ 918 bhp for the all-electric version. The performance is equally impressive, with a 0-100kph time of 3.3 seconds and a top speed of 230kph.

    The most striking change is in terms of range. Lotus has adopted a more compact battery supplied by CATL. Its capacity has been reduced from 112 kWh on the electric version to 70 kWh on this plug-in hybrid variant. Despite this reduction, range in electric mode remains particularly high for a PHEV: 420 km according to the CLTC cycle, which corresponds to around 350 km on the European cycle (WLTP). With the internal combustion engine, total range then exceeds 1,200 kilometres.

    Ultra-fast charging for a plug-in hybrid

    The other major innovation concerns recharging. The Lotus Eletre X is based on a 900-volt electrical architecture capable of handling up to 430 kW of power.

    Thanks to this technology, the battery can go from 20% to 80% charge in just nine minutes. An unprecedented figure for a plug-in hybrid vehicle. This is far more efficient than some of its rivals, such as the Porsche Cayenne Turbo E-Hybrid or the Range Rover Sport P550e.

    A sign of a change in strategy

    Above all, the arrival of this hybrid version illustrates a change in strategy for Lotus. When the Chinese group Geely relaunched the British brand in 2017, the stated aim was to transform Lotus into an all-electric premium manufacturer.

    But the dynamics of the car market have evolved more slowly than expected. In China, plug-in hybrids now account for almost 40% of new car sales, compared with around 15% for 100% electric models.

    The Lotus Eletre X could thus become the first representative of a new generation of Lotus hybrid models. According to industry indications, the Lotus Emeya saloon could adopt similar technology around 2027, while the sporty Lotus Emira could follow in 2028.

    source: TopGear

    This scenario would mark the end of the “all-electric” strategy announced a few years ago.

    Two new products from BYD will remove one of the last obstacles to electric cars

    For many years, recharging time has been one of the major obstacles to the adoption of gentler mobility. Now, the promise of recharging as quickly as a full tank of petrol is becoming a reality. And the reason? A technological advance unveiled by BYD that could mark a turning point for electromobility: the Blade 2.0 battery and Flash Charging technology. At the heart of this announcement is an architecture capable of achieving 1,500 kW of charging power, a level never before seen in the automotive industry. Under the best conditions, BYD claims that it would be possible to recover 400 to 500 kilometres of range in just five minutes.

    source : BYD

    A new generation of batteries to break new ground

    After the arrival on the market in 2020 of the Blade Battery, a battery made in BYD, it is now the turn of its second version to see the light of day. The press release confirms that it retains the LFP (lithium iron phosphate) chemistry that made the reputation of the first generation for its safety and durability. But it has evolved significantly on a number of technical points:

    • improved energy density,
    • much higher load capacity,
    • better thermal management,
    • structural architecture integrated into the vehicle using Cell-to-Body technology.

    The results are spectacular: some 100% electric models equipped with this new generation battery can now exceed a range of 1,000 km according to the Chinese CLTC cycle. This is particularly true of the top-of-the-range Yangwang U7 saloon, capable of a range of 1,006 km, and the sporty Denza Z9 GT, which would exceed 1,030 km with this technology.

    source: BYD – R&D representatives of

    Unfortunately, BYD did not provide any information on energy density, apart from the following figure: “+5%”.

    So yes, these staggering range figures are based on the Chinese cycle, which is generally more optimistic than Europe’s WLTP. Nevertheless, they testify to the technological leap made by the world leader in battery technology.

    Recharging almost as fast as a full tank of petrol

    If the batteries haven’t convinced you, wait until you see what the Flash Charging stations are all about. The manufacturer promises a recharge that will take the battery from 10% to 70% in around 5 minutes. Another value: connecting to a Flash Charging point with a vehicle equipped with the Blade 2.0 battery will increase the level from 10% to 97% in less than 9 minutes.

    source : BYD

    For drivers living in extremely cold areas, don’t worry: BYD has thought of everything, and it’s amazing. The Blade 2.0 takes the battery from 20% to 97% in approximately 11 minutes at -20°C and a few seconds more at -30°C.

    To achieve this performance, BYD is relying on a dedicated infrastructure capable of delivering up to 1,500 kW of power, several times the power of current rapid charging stations in Europe.

    And as well as being efficient, they are also designed to make the charging experience more pleasant. You may have wondered why the station is T-shaped? Well, it’s to allow the cable to be suspended with a ‘zero gravity’ system, so that it doesn’t drag along the ground and the customer doesn’t have to bear its weight.

    Source : Autohome

    But is this infrastructure accessible now? The answer is yes, but only on Chinese roads. BYD has already installed 4,239 Flash Charging stations across China and plans to operate 20,000 by the end of the year. The brand promises that the whole world will be able to benefit from these infrastructures, even if no date or strategy has yet been communicated.

    A clear message: electrics just got easier

    The aim behind this technological demonstration is obvious: to do away with what manufacturers call “charging anxiety”. For years, range and charging time have been the two main arguments put forward by sceptics of electric cars.

    From now on, with a range of over 1,000 kilometres and a recharge time of just a few minutes, BYD wants to show that these obstacles are about to become a thing of the past. It remains to be seen whether this performance will be confirmed in mass-market models in China and abroad.

    Alfa Romeo’s year 2025: records and transition on the way

    At the beginning of March, Alfa Romeo published its sales results for 2025. The results? The Italian brand has recorded worldwide growth of over 20% compared to 2024, with more than 73,000 vehicles sold internationally. In a car market that is still uneven and under pressure, this growth shows that the Italian brand is back, but above all that it is moving forward in a thoughtful way with the energy transition.

    source: Alfa Romeo

    Solid momentum in Europe and beyond

    According to the press release issued by the Stellantis Group on Tuesday 3 March 2025, Europe remains the main growth driver for the Italian brand, with sales up by more than 31%. The United Kingdom (+80.1%), France (+41.9%), Italy (+20.7%), Germany (+20.5%) and Spain (+15.1%) posted particularly strong increases, symbolising the relevance of Alfa Romeo’s product repositioning, particularly in the compact premium segment.

    Important figures for Europe, but that’s not all. Alfa Romeo also recorded significant growth in other key markets. In the Middle East & Africa region, growth reached 16.3%. In Morocco, the brand ranked second in the premium market in terms of growth, with an impressive 65% increase in registrations, while in Turkey it posted growth of 38.7%.

    But it is in Asia that the dynamic is even more marked, with +43.8% compared to 2024. Japan stands out with exceptional growth of +71.4% over the year. Alfa Romeo announced that it had relaunched its presence in Taiwan and Malaysia. These results speak for themselves: the brand is enjoying international success, particularly in these dynamic emerging markets.

    source : Alpha Roméo

    Electrification at a gentle pace

    Alfa Romeo is adopting a strategy of gradual electrification, moving slowly towards the energy transition rather than rushing its customers. The brand is combining combustion, hybrid and 100% electric powertrains, in order to retain the sporty, premium DNA for which it is renowned. For the time being, the Junior remains the only 100% electric model actually available, illustrating this cautious approach: of the 60,000 vehicles distributed in 41 markets by 2025, this zero-emission variant represents a minority share of deliveries, showing that electromobility is making progress, but at a measured pace, far from immediate mass adoption.

    Santo Ficili, CEO of Alfa Romeo, sums up this approach perfectly:

    • “Exceeding 20% growth worldwide, with Europe at +31%, means one thing is very clear: Alfa Romeo is back in the race. But what matters most is the quality of this trajectory. Junior has broadened our customer base while remaining true to the brand’s sporting DNA. Tonale is now entering its first full year with the new model and is a strategic pillar for 2026.
    source: Alfa Romeo

    While the initial target was an all-electric range by 2027, the brand is now adopting a more pragmatic approach, incorporating light hybrids and plug-in hybrids into this objective. The idea is to adapt the range to the realities of different markets, where the level of infrastructure, public incentives and demand vary greatly.

    XPENG announces worldwide delivery of the VLA 2.0 in 2027 with Volkswagen as launch partner

    On 1 March 2026, via an official press release and an internal memo from He Xiaopeng dated 24 February, XPeng Motors announced that global delivery of its second-generation intelligent driving system, VLA 2.0, will begin in 2027. In this global roll-out, Volkswagen is confirmed as the first launch partner in the Chinese market.

    source: XPENG

    A change in architecture: from sequential pipeline to end-to-end AI

    The big news behind this announcement, apart from the fact that worldwide deliveries of its intelligent driving system will begin in 2027, is that VLA 2.0 (Vision-Language-Action) marks a major conceptual break with traditional in-vehicle systems. Traditionally, automated driving architectures operate according to a three-stage logic:

    • Perception (Vision)
    • Translation into intermediate language
    • Decision/Action

    The problem with the so-called ‘traditional’ model is that it creates latency, like a translator between the eye and the foot on the brake pedal.

    With version 2.0, XPENG breaks this pattern: the vision goes directly to the action, without passing through an intermediate language stage. The system creates what some describe as “implicit tokens”: a computer language internal to the AI that enables faster, smoother interpretation of driving situations.

    This approach is expected to offer a number of operational advantages:

    • Drastic reduction in processing times
    • More real and more human reactions
    • Ability to manage complex scenarios without detailed HD maps
    • Dynamic recognition of road signs, gestures or changes in context
    Source : Volkswagen

    Public road tests and “drive anywhere” capabilities

    The first vehicles equipped with VLA 2.0 have begun testing on open roads in China, with public trials scheduled for later in 2026. According to various statements by the Chinese brand, the system is now capable of handling difficult environments:

    • heavy urban traffic
    • narrow lanes
    • irregular or unmapped roads
    • standstill starts and complex interactions

    Based on early test data, XPENG claims that VLA 2.0 delivers a ~23% improvement in driving efficiency, with peak hour performance in Guangzhou comparable to that of experienced human drivers, and significantly better than traditional Level 2 systems.

    Hardware power: the Turing chip, the heart of the reactor

    To operate and be so promising, the VLA 2.0 relies on the Turing AI chip designed in-house by XPENG, capable of delivering up to 2,250 TOPS (trillions of operations per second) per unit in the most powerful versions.
    This massive computing power means that very large AI models can be run directly in the vehicle, without relying on the cloud. It is this on-board power that guarantees ultra-fast reactions – essential when you need to anticipate an unpredictable cyclist or a pothole in a fraction of a second.

    Volkswagen, a strategic and now historic partner

    The announcement that Volkswagen is now the first launch partner for VLA 2.0 on the Chinese market sends out a strong signal.
    Firstly, it is a symbolic milestone: it is the first time that a major historic Western manufacturer has adopted an advanced autonomous driving platform developed by a Chinese manufacturer to equip its own vehicles.

    source: Volkswagen

    Secondly, the agreement is not limited to simple software integration. Volkswagen will also be adopting the proprietary Turing AI chip developed by XPeng Motors, the computing heart of the VLA 2.0. In other words, the system’s hardware and software architecture will be based directly on the XPENG technology ecosystem.

    And it’s worth remembering that this partnership didn’t come out of nowhere. In 2023, Volkswagen invested around $700 million to acquire a 4.99% stake in XPENG, as part of a wider agreement to jointly develop electric vehicles for the Chinese market. This stake means that the German manufacturer already has a direct interest in the industrial and technological success of its partner.

    Objective: total autonomy within 1-3 years

    He Xiaopeng, Managing Director of XPeng, confirmed: “XPENG’s VLA 2.0 is the first version designed to achieve fully autonomous driving and will evolve at an unprecedented rate. We expect full autonomy to arrive within one to three years, making autonomous driving a natural part of people’s daily journeys.”
